Default More info...

Click the image to open in full size.


Four Cylinder, Four Valve, FSI Turbocharged
Gasoline Engine
Engine Block
- Cast Iron Crankcase
- Balancer Shafts in Crankcase
- Forged Steel Crankshaft
- Sump-Mounted Oil Pump --
Chain-Driven by
Crankshaft
- Timing Gear Chain --
Front End of Engine
- Balancer - Chain-Driven at Front End of Engine
Cylinder Head
- 4-Valve Cylinder Head
- 1 INA Intake Camshaft Adjuster
Intake Manifold
- Tumble Flap
Fuel Supply
- Demand Controlled on Low and High-pressure Ends
- Multi-Port High-pressure Injector
Engine Management
- MED 17 Engine Control Module
- Hot-Film Air Mass Flow with Integral Temperature
Sensor
- Throttle Valve with Contactless Sensor
- Map-Controlled Ignition with Cylinder-Selective,
Digital Knock Control
- Single-Spark Ignition Coils
Turbocharging
- Integral Exhaust Turbocharger
- Charge-Air Cooler
- Boost Pressure Control with Overpressure
- Electrical Wastegate Valve
Exhaust
- Single-Chamber Exhaust System with Close-Coupled
Pre-Catalyst
Combustion Process
- Fuel Straight Injection
